Are there items you don’t buy?

Yes. While Preloved Gold purchases a broad range of precious metal items, there are certain materials and products we are unable to accept. This is because not all items commonly associated with metals contain sufficient precious metal content, or they fall outside our scope of trade.

We understand that it is not always easy to determine what type of metal an item contains. Many materials can appear similar at a glance, particularly when plated or mixed with base metals. For this reason, Preloved Gold specialises in professionally testing and assessing items to accurately identify their precious metal content and provide a fair valuation where applicable.

Every item submitted is carefully examined using industry-standard testing methods, ensuring transparency and accuracy throughout the appraisal process. Where items do not contain recoverable precious metals, we are unable to provide an offer.

Items we do not purchase include:

  • Computer parts and electronic components
  • Automotive catalytic converters
  • Costume or fashion jewellery
  • Gold-plated or silver-plated items of any kind
  • Rocks, ores, or unrefined mineral samples
  • Platinum flake or industrial residue materials
  • Jewellers’ polishing dust or sweepings
  • Platinum laboratory equipment or labware
  • Medical-grade platinum items such as catheters
  • Electrophoresis electrodes or similar laboratory consumables
  • Loose diamonds, gemstones, or pearls (unless set within precious metal jewellery being evaluated for metal content)

These exclusions are generally based on either the absence of sufficient precious metal content, regulatory considerations, or the specialist nature of the materials involved, which fall outside standard precious metal refining and resale processes.
